Output 0f35dbe783217c48ed95edef34cd8ea5b8f53e55d096778da55947e5a513874e:101

value
11977183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f570d7561df697b8889dc993fdf943edcb4c3bb OP_EQUAL
address
3K8jGhgDWpchGNY7AP8XeeD4NEQ4XPQf6F
transaction
0f35dbe783217c48ed95edef34cd8ea5b8f53e55d096778da55947e5a513874e
spent
true